Kindergarten “Self Portraits”
March 18, 2021 in St. James Notices /by Saint James SchoolKindergarten “self portraits” using up-cycled book pages. As part of this Lenten art lesson with Mrs. Rafferty, classes also discussed how recycled materials might be used by children whose families do not have extra money for art supplies (or art supplies are not as easy to acquire). 1st Graders Build Nests in Stream
March 15, 2021 in St. James Notices /by Saint James SchoolFirst Grade STREAM class fun: Students discussed the story, “Horton Hatches the Egg,” then made their own nests from the provided materials. The challenge was to keep the egg safe if an elephant (or in this case, a gallon of water disguised as an elephant) “sat” on it.
